>>>Myth currently supports:
>>>   1) Blank frame
>>>   2) Scene change
>>>   3) Blank frame with scene change
>>>   4) Logo (the little channel identifier logo)
>>>   255) All (combines all the above--basically blank frame with scene 
>>>change and logo)
>>>
>>Does the current commercial detection (Logo method) detect not only the 
>>channel logo, but the TV Rating logo?
>>
No.

>>I have noticed that most of the 
>>shows in the US show the TV rating immediately after the commercials 
>>when the show resumes playing. It stays on the screen for about 5 to 10 
>>seconds then goes away. It won't help with detecting the beginning of 
>>the commercial but it would be a great way to know when the commercials end.
>>    
>>
Perhaps that's why it's not currently used (not enough benefit to 
justify the effort).

>One thing I've started to notice lately is some channels put a random
>delay on when the logo appears after a commercial. (not sure if they
>remove the logo randomly before the commercial starts though)
>
>This totally throws off the commercial flagger.
>
>Perhaps a simple:
>
>Find logo, rewind to nearest blank frame, if less then half the total
>commercial length, seek there instead?
>  
>
Sounds a bit like the "All" method (not quite the same algorithm, but 
well worth giving it a try...).
